Involvement with the
Campaign for Real Beauty:
Stacy Nadeau is a brave Dove "Real Woman"
who stood proudly along with 5 other women in
her underwear in the summer of 2005 as part
of the Dove Campaign for Real Beauty. This campaign
and the “Real Women” ads which celebrated
the diversity of body shapes and sizes generated
national attention when they hit billboards
from coast to coast. Stacy and the other women
truly brought the mission of the Campaign for
Real Beauty to life which is to make more women
feel beautiful everyday by widening today’s
stereotypical view of beauty and inspiring women
to take great care of themselves.
The campaign has received unprecedented national
media coverage and has been included in more
than 85 national stories! Stacy has appeared
on everything from a ten minute Today show segment,
to CNN and a talk show circuit normally reserved
for movie stars: Ellen, Dr. Phil, Tyra and even
Oprah, twice!

Follow-On Projects:
Stacy extended her role in the Campaign for
Real Beauty by participating in various speaking
engagements and activities to help raise the
self-esteem of young women. She has attended
local Girl Scouts events in the Chicago area
speaking to young women on the importance of
positive self-esteem and how media can influence
their views. She has participated in similar
self-esteem building activities at the Chicago
Boys & Girls Club as well. Stacy accepted
an award, on behalf of Dove, at the National
Association of Anorexia Nervosa and Associated
Disorders Conference.
